A remarkable microscope which reveals to our eyes ob- jects only 500,000th of an inch in size. These are not dreamings for the future, but present day facts. They give but an inkling of the unpredictable things to come. For, just as our country's geographical frontiers were pushed forward a few gen- erations ago, the frontiers of world knowl- edge are being pushed forward today. Each gain in our accumulated knowledge, no matter how small or seemingly unim- portant, may be the means of showing us the way to stupendous achievements in the future. Great advances do not come by sur- prise. Man had to learn to write before he could learn to print, and it was 450 years after he learned to make type be- fore he ,could produce a machine to set type for him. Maxwell, in l867, proved the existence of electric waves, Hertz, twenty years later, produced, reflected, bent, and polarized them. lt remained for Marconi, in l886, to put them to practical use as the wireless waves that since l92l we have known as radio. ln all fields of knowledge the frontiers exist. Science, perhaps, has brought about the mosturevolutionary changes in our lives, but it remains for these changes to pene- trate to all fields. We study and work to learn about what has been done so that this knowledge may be used to draw away more curtains in the future. New frontiers are forever with us to be won.
